Convert Y = -7/2x-11 to Standard Form​
monitta

Answer:

7x + 2y = -22

Step-by-step explanation:

Standard form looks like Ax + By = C.

Start with Y = -7/2x-11.  Better to write that as Y = (-7/2)x - 11 to emphasize that the coefficient of x is the fraction -7/2.

Move the (-7/2)x term to the left:

(7/2)x + y = -11

Multiply all terms by 2 to eliminate the fractions:

7x + 2y = -22 (answer)
